How to Pass a Solar Inspection | Ultimate Guide

Installation methods – inspectors will check that solar panel mounting follow code requirements for roof penetration, lag bolt quantity/depth, etc. They''ll verify mounting equipment is properly grounded and installed securely enough to withstand wind loads.

How do you inspect a solar panel?

Here's a comprehensive solar panel inspection checklist to guide you: Visual Inspection Check for Physical Damage: Look for cracks, chips, or scratches on the panels. Inspect Mounting Hardware: Ensure all bolts and brackets are secure and there is no rust or corrosion. Examine Wiring and Connections: Check for any loose, frayed, or damaged wires.

When should a solar system be inspected?

2. Post-Installation Inspection Immediately after the installation, a post-installation inspection should take place to verify the quality of workmanship, proper connection of components, and compliance with industry standards. This inspection ensures that the solar system is correctly installed and ready to generate electricity safely.
